Kyocera FS-C5350DN Admin pass reset after lockout
Hi everyone, I have a FS-C5350DN that someone has graciously gone into and changed the admin password to an unknow password. The company I work with is in the prosses of updating all of our printer admin passes and I need to be able to change this one. I've been attempting to update it with the command
!R! KSUS "AUIO", "CUSTOM:Admin Password = 'admin00'"; STAT1; EXIT;
Any advice?
